San Clemente Palace Venice located on its own 20-acre private island, 10-minute from St. Marks’ Square aboard the hotel’s traditional wooden boats is an ultimate get away.

The private island church - built in 1131 and renovated in the 17th century - is part of the hotel’s historic campus and one of the three church-in-church concepts in Europe. The 182-room, 50-suites 32-special suites “palace” having the most luxury room options is at the center of a gracious park littered with contemporary sculptures. The resort’s grounds include a 21 meter heated outdoor swimming pool surrounded by cabanas and chaises longues in the middle of palm garden, 1-mile jogging track by the lagoon. The open-air Le Specialità poolside trattoria and bar, as well as the Longevity SPA, tennis court, open air cinema and golf pitch & putt.

The rooms and suites at the San Clemente Palace are spacious and furnished lavishly with Venetian inspiration having very high ceilings, spacey gardens for inhabiting pheasants that freely walk around the island.
The hotel’s Acquerello fine-dining restaurant faces the lagoon and the Venetian skyline. In addition to the array of sculptures located throughout the gardens, the interior of the San Clemente Palace boasts a massive private art collection. The hotel’s chic Clemente Bar offers curated cocktails; guests gather at the gracious outdoor Sunset Bar to watch the sun descend into the Venetian Lagoon.
The hotel’s 10 minutes shuttle rides to and from Piazza San Marco operate in every 30 minutes from early morning to beyond midnight and are complimentary for hotel guests.
